Former Anambra Governor, Ezeife Urges South East Governors To Reject Almajiris, Says They are Security Risk to Region

Former Governor of Anambra State, Dr Chukwuemeka Ezeife, has said the recent influx of Almajiris into the South East poses a huge danger to the region.

Ezeife who expressed concerns on the development on Saturday called on South East Governors to reject the Almajiris as their presence is unacceptable.

“I am worried about this development and this is totally unacceptable to us in Igboland and their presence in the South East portends danger.

“These are young men who are not married and have no visible means of livelihood and with such idle men, it is a security risk for us in the South East.

“These are the same people that are always used by their former benefactors to attack the Igbo people and their business in the North because they depend on them for sustenance and with such unemployed men coming down to the South East, it is a potential danger for us here” he said.

“Yes the Bible said love your neighbour as you love yourself and because of that, we pity the Almajiris over their condition but they should help themselves with something meaningful, but their presence in the South East is totally unacceptable to us here in the South East.

“Our governors should be mindful of the grave consequences of allowing these people to come to the South East because we have no business with them and we do not share anything with them.

“Very soon, they will begin to lay claim to our land and our properties and this is the monster that the Northern leaders created to subjugate and frustrate the South East and South South but with the COVID-19 pandemic they no longer want them around then and they are sending them down to the South and expect us to receive them.

“The South East governors should be aware of the fact that they are the chief security Officers of their respective states and they are also accountable to the people of Igbo land,” he warned
